Tips for storing the printer, supplies, and paper ● Keep them in a cool place with no humidity. ● Keep them covered so that dusts cannot be accumulated. ● Keep them dry. Printer ● ● When moving the printer, do not tilt or turn it upside down. Otherwise, the inside of the printer may be contaminated by toner, which can cause damage to the printer or reduce print quality. When moving the printer, make sure at least four people are holding the printer securely. Toner cartridge/ Imaging unit To get the best, print quality from the toner cartridge, keep the following guidelines in mind: ● Do not remove the toner cartridge from its package until it's ready to use. ● Do not refill the toner cartridge. ● Store toner cartridges in the same environment as your printer. ● Keep it in a level place so the toner dust is not slanted to one side. Paper Store print media in its ream wrapper until you are ready to use it. Place cartons on pallets or shelves, not on the floor. Do not place heavy objects on top of the paper, whether it is packed or unpacked. Keep it away from moisture or other conditions that can cause it to wrinkle or curl. Store paper in temperatures between 15° and 30°C (59° to 86°F) and humidity between 10% and 70%. 120 Chapter 8 Supplies and accessories ENWW
